Impact on Children of Parental Mental Illness/Substance Misuse

On-line training

Aim:

To raise awareness of the hidden impact on children and young people of substance misuse or mental illness within the family and increase practitioners use of ERSCP Hidden Harm Tool Kit

 

Learning Outcomes:

By the end of this course you will

 

  • Have considered what life might be like for children living with parents/carers who are using drugs or alcohol and/or have a mental health problem
  • Have an understanding of the short and long term impact on children
  • Have explored how substance misuse and/or mental illness affects parents/carers ability to meet their children’s needs
  • Start to use the ERSCB Hidden Harm Tool Kit and other relevant tools

 

NB: In addition to the 3.5 hour virtual course participants will be given preparation work to complete prior to joining the training.
